**Ticket PRX-7: Spooler vault sealed**

The Inkbarrow printer-spooler microservice can't fetch its signing certs — the Quenchly vault resealed after the patch window. Print jobs are queuing, nothing lost. New hires: do not restart the spooler pods; they'll crash-loop without certs. Unseal the vault first, confirm cert fetch in the logs, then drain the queue. Standard unseal steps are in the runbook, section four. The recovery passphrase required for the unseal step appears below.

strongbox words: raleth-ralvan-aldiel-ulaax-istix-zorok-kelax-kelox-wenix-zormir-aldix-silael-normir

The Cartwheel inventory-service key used by the vending-machine restock planner was rotated today per quarterly policy. Old key is revoked effective immediately. Update the planner's deploy config and the nightly forecast job; both read the same credential. No code changes needed — the auth header format is unchanged. Staging was already updated and the smoke tests pass. Document any other consumers you find; we believe the list is complete but haven't audited the archived cron boxes. The new key follows below.

API key for yahig-tadup: kto7_ubizbYm

## Deployment: Baseline File Handling

The Larkspur static-analysis service ships with a baseline file that records all findings accepted at the time of adoption. During deployment, the baseline must be copied into the runtime volume before the analyzer starts; otherwise every legacy finding resurfaces as new and floods the triage queue. Verify the checksum after copying. The analyzer reads the baseline path and suppression rules from the configuration values below.

deployment values, yahag-tawef:
ZORWYN_HOST=zorwyn.tolvaqlabs.internal
ZORWYN_PORT=9300

## Ticket: Signature verification failure — FeedWarden validator

FeedWarden's podcast feed validator began rejecting signed manifests from the Castwick ingest pipeline at 04:12 this morning. Verification fails with a digest mismatch on every feed, including known-good fixtures, which suggests the trust store was updated out of band rather than feed tampering. No unauthorized access indicators so far. For your review, the currently deployed verification key is reproduced below.

deploy key for fahap-yawep: bky9_Sz7nfBZP5